Trip Highlights
- Revel in the first lighthouse ever built in Iceland before indulging in the Michelin-starred cuisine of Reykjavik
- Traverse across a beach at sunset and wander through a 4,000-year-old lava field
- Ride horseback across fields before submerging in a geothermal pool and discovering the haunting beauty of Strandir
- Transport to the past at the turf houses of Glaumbaer, which have been standing since the 9th century
- Fly in a helicopter over the lava fields of Lake Myvatn and follow in the footsteps of Iceland’s ancestors during a tour of Akureyri
- Stroll through the secretive rock formations of Dimmuborgir before basking in the majesty of Aldeyjarfoss
- Tantalize your senses with a twist on Icelandic cuisine before traveling to a remote town that will charm you with its untouched beauty
- Admire the breathtaking peaks of Vestrahorn as it slopes into a black sand beach that stretches as far as the eye can see
- Luxuriate at the canyon of waterfalls before ascending to the top of a bluff that towers over a black volcanic plain
- Descend into a 4,000-year-old magma chamber before relaxing at the Blue Lagoon’s exclusive retreat

We selected Zicasso's tour company to assist us with arranging a 12-day self-driving tour around the entire island of Iceland starting in mid-May. In addition to visiting and hiking the many wondrous geological sites on our own, we wanted to schedule some tours to reach areas we couldn't by ourselves, along with a few stops at the local hot springs.
The trip planner carefully listened to our wants and needs during an initial video call, and then curated a custom travel plan with all event, rental car, and hotel bookings pre-arranged and pre-paid. We just needed to show up, drive around the country, and enjoy, and that's just what we did.
His planned itinerary matched our interests very well, leaving just enough time between regions and sites to cover 95% of his recommendations. I was able to fully indulge in my photography, while the wife and I got to enjoy some spectacular tours (whale and puffin boat ride, a glacier climb, ice lagoon boat ride, ATV tour, super Jeep tour, yet another whale boat ride, and a delicious lunch at a tomato farm). All of the tour operators were friendly, entertaining, and capable, so they were well selected for us.
We stayed at eight different hotels, ranging from the typical chain in Reykjavík to mostly boutique hotels in stunning locations along the Ring Road. Our favorite (for the food) was a cabin operated by a local farmer whose farm-fresh meals were simply extraordinary. All of the hotels were clean and comfortable, and not too distant from the previous accommodation or the activities and sightseeing stops.
Several times, I texted the trip planner for help arranging dinner reservations, finding unique stores, or alerting the hotel of our late arrival or early departure. He came through every time without delay. Having a local Zicasso agent like him, with expert knowledge and 24/7 assistance, is invaluable for the peace of mind essential for a successful trip in a foreign land.
If we had any regrets, it was in not allowing ourselves a more relaxed pace and extended stay in Iceland. The typical tourist to Iceland spends less than 10 days there, so we thought an additional two days was a luxury. However, covering 2,100 miles in 12 days, with numerous and frequent stops, is no easy feat. Sleep was often a luxury, as we often stayed out late for the 10:30 sunset, only to start out early the next morning for a 7:30 breakfast and departure to the next destination. This was certainly no fault of the trip agent, as he made sure our travel was as trouble-free as it was. We will surely use this travel company’s services for a return trip.
